duvida delphi c/ firebird

Delphi

13/06/2012

Ola, pessoal tenho um programa em delphi7 e estou querendo saber o seguinte
gostaria de saber se tem uma forma de iniciar o programa sem ter que abrir o ibconsole manualmente para acessar o banco
ou seja, todas as vezes que inicio o programa tenho que abrir o ib console antes, iniciar o banco e colocar a senha login senao da erro no delphi, aparece a mensagem: unavailable database mesmo estando loginprompt:=false;

após iniciar o banco ele funciona normal, há alguma forma de iniciar o banco via programação;
Marcelo Augusto

Marcelo Augusto

Curtidas 0

Respostas

Joao Moreira

Joao Moreira

13/06/2012

passa ai os parâmetros da sua conexão com o firebird, ta usando DBX ou Interbase ?
GOSTEI 0
Marcelo Augusto

Marcelo Augusto

13/06/2012

passa ai os parâmetros da sua conexão com o firebird, ta usando DBX ou Interbase ?

estou usando o interbase
estou usando ibdatabase, ibtransaction
quando quero acessar uso no formshow ibquery, ou ibtable.active:=true;
GOSTEI 0
Wesley Yamazack

Wesley Yamazack

13/06/2012

Opa Marcelo, o que o amigo João quis dizer foi pra você informar os parâmetros da sua conexão, estes são encontrados no seu TIBDatabase através da propriedade Params, seria algo mais ou menos assim:

drivername=MYSQL
blobsize=-1
Database=bdcliente
HostName=localhost
localecode=0000
Password=root
User_Name=1234mudar
compressed=False
encrypted=False


Com esta informação conseguimos saber como esta configurada a sua conexão.

Um abraço
GOSTEI 0
Marcelo Augusto

Marcelo Augusto

13/06/2012

Opa Marcelo, o que o amigo João quis dizer foi pra você informar os parâmetros da sua conexão, estes são encontrados no seu TIBDatabase através da propriedade Params, seria algo mais ou menos assim:

drivername=MYSQL
blobsize=-1
Database=bdcliente
HostName=localhost
localecode=0000
Password=root
User_Name=1234mudar
compressed=False
encrypted=False


Com esta informação conseguimos saber como esta configurada a sua conexão.

Um abraço


Nos parametros stringlist está deste jeito, somente user_name e Password

user_name=SYSDBA
password=master

GOSTEI 0
Marcelo Augusto

Marcelo Augusto

13/06/2012

Opa Marcelo, o que o amigo João quis dizer foi pra você informar os parâmetros da sua conexão, estes são encontrados no seu TIBDatabase através da propriedade Params, seria algo mais ou menos assim:

drivername=MYSQL
blobsize=-1
Database=bdcliente
HostName=localhost
localecode=0000
Password=root
User_Name=1234mudar
compressed=False
encrypted=False


Com esta informação conseguimos saber como esta configurada a sua conexão.

Um abraço


Nos parametros stringlist está deste jeito, somente user_name e Password

user_name=SYSDBA
password=master
ja no database componente editor esta assim

connection local radiogroup marcado
database C:\IBNAF2\IBNAF
user sysdba
pass master
login prompt chedkbox false



GOSTEI 0
POSTAR